“Trump Presents AI ‘Treatment Plan’ for Trump Derangement Syndrome”

Former US President Donald Trump has shared a video created using artificial intelligence where he appears as a doctor presenting a “treatment plan” for Trump Derangement Syndrome (TDS).

The 90-second video features various celebrities who have criticized Trump in the past as his TDS patients, including Robert De Niro and Julia Roberts. Trump introduces himself as “Dr. Trump” in the video, offering a treatment plan for those diagnosed with TDS.

One of the patients, Rosie O’Donnell, mentions she has been struggling for over a decade but has seen improvement after following Dr. Trump’s advice. Another virtual patient, Whoopi Goldberg, expresses her belief that TDS would affect her for the rest of her life.

In the video, Trump expresses uncertainty about helping some of the patients, remarking on the severity of their conditions. Robert De Niro, one of the featured patients, describes his struggles with anger and insomnia, attributing his misery to his TDS.

Julia Roberts, another celebrity in the clip, talks about feeling significantly aged due to her concerns about the current political climate. Trump concludes the video by suggesting simple remedies like avoiding fake news, praying, and enjoying a Diet Coke to alleviate anxiety.

The concept of TDS originated from psychiatrist Charles Krauthammer, who initially coined the term “Bush Derangement Syndrome” during George W. Bush’s presidency in 2003. The syndrome was later adapted during Trump’s 2016 campaign.
